Castillo set to become Peru president as rival Fujimori says she will recognise result

Daughter of jailed former president says she will respect the law after failure of appeals against tight election result

Peruvian right-wing presidential candidate Keiko Fujimori has admitted she is headed for defeat in last month’s election, but accused socialist rival Pedro Castillo of winning in an “illegitimate” manner and pledged to mobilise her supporters.

Castillo came out of the run-off vote on 6 June ahead by a scant 44,000 votes. The official result has been delayed by appeals from Fujimori aimed at annulling some ballots over fraud accusations, despite little evidence.
